Shaun Rogers was born on July 22, 1985, in Baltimore, MD. He began group skating lessons at the age of eight in his hometown of Millersville, MD, after participating in a school skating party. Shaun trains in Newark, Delaware, and represents the University of Delaware Figure Skating Club.
For fun, Shaun likes to hang out with his friends, especially people from the rink, and play video games. His goals later in life are to become a coach, get a Psychology degree, and be a winning poker player.
Shaun received the Presidential Academic Excellence Award (1998) and John Hopkins Award for Academic Excellence in Mathematics (1999). His most prized possessions are his national medals, especially his 2000 U.S. novice gold medal.
